Hi everyone, I thought it was summertime and more quiet on the music making front. Holidays... But that was a mistake. The amount of new songs is breathtaking. And they are good! Now I added my song as well, and hopefully also good: https://soundcloud.com/user-296497130/confusingIt's called Confusing. A light song with some winks in the lyrics. I wasn't sure if I had to sing it in C minor or E minor. I did both, but finally chose the latter. The style is called Mumblin. The tempo is 95, key E minor. I changed nearly all instruments, but the main one is the bariton guitar. I also have a fiddle in it and I used my keyboard for an extra rhythm section. And my wife sang along. (no, joke. It's me with some semitones). I hope you will enjoy it and don't mind my sense of humor. Handy flash drive tip: Always try plugging in a USB device the wrong way first? If your flash drive (or other USB plug) doesn't have a symbol to indicate which way is up, look for the side with a seam on the metal connector (it only has a line across one side) - that's the side that either faces down or to the left, depending on your port placement.
